What Types of Medications Are Commonly Associated with Hearing Issues?
Medications play an essential role in treating a wide range of health conditions; however, it is crucial to recognise that some commonly prescribed drugs can significantly compromise hearing health. A number of these medications possess ototoxic properties, which means they can cause harm to the intricate structures within the inner ear and disrupt the pathways associated with hearing. Notable categories of medications that have been identified as influential in hearing impairment include:
- Aminoglycoside antibiotics
- Chemotherapy agents
- Non-steroidal anti-inflammatory drugs (NSAIDs)
- Loop diuretics
- Salicylates (such as aspirin)
- Quinine and other anti-malarial treatments
- <a href="https://www.earwaxremoval.net/tinnitus-causes-and-effective-management-strategies/">Antidepressants</a>
- Certain antivirals
These medications are often indispensable for treating infections, alleviating pain, or managing chronic health conditions. Nevertheless, it is essential for both patients and healthcare providers to remain vigilant regarding their potential adverse effects, ensuring that informed decisions are made concerning treatment options and necessary precautions are observed.
How Do Medications Contribute to Ototoxicity?
Ototoxicity refers to the process by which specific medications inflict damage on the ear, potentially resulting in hearing loss or balance-related disorders. The mechanisms through which these medications exert ototoxic effects are multifaceted and complex. A variety of drugs can disturb the delicate fluid balance within the inner ear or harm the hair cells that convert sound waves into electrical signals for the brain. This disruption may occur through several processes, including:
– Direct toxicity to the hair cells causing cellular damage
– Interference with the body’s oxidative stress responses
– Alterations in blood circulation to the structures of the inner ear
A thorough understanding of these mechanisms is essential for identifying individuals who may be at heightened risk, thus allowing for timely interventions and modifications in treatment plans aimed at safeguarding hearing health.

Understanding the Risks Associated with Aminoglycoside Antibiotics
Aminoglycoside antibiotics form a well-established category of medications critical for treating severe bacterial infections. However, their ototoxic properties can result in significant hearing impairment. Commonly used aminoglycosides, such as gentamicin and tobramycin, have been associated with damage to the hair cells in the inner ear, often resulting in irreversible hearing loss.
The mechanism underlying this ototoxicity involves the accumulation of the drug within the inner ear, disrupting the functionality of sensory hair cells. Patients receiving treatment with these antibiotics should be closely monitored, especially those with pre-existing hearing conditions or those undergoing prolonged therapy. Regular audiometric evaluations throughout treatment can assist in the early detection of any emerging hearing issues.
How Do Chemotherapy Agents Contribute to Hearing Damage?
Certain chemotherapy drugs are recognised for inducing hearing loss as a side effect, with cisplatin being one of the most commonly implicated agents. Cisplatin can cause both auditory and vestibular toxicity, impacting both balance and hearing perception. Other chemotherapy agents, such as carboplatin and oxaliplatin, present similar risks.
The ramifications of these chemotherapy agents on hearing health raise significant concerns, particularly among paediatric patients who may suffer long-lasting effects. Healthcare professionals frequently recommend baseline hearing evaluations prior to initiating chemotherapy and periodic assessments throughout treatment to monitor any changes in hearing function.
Loop Diuretics: Understanding Risks to Hearing Health
Loop diuretics, commonly prescribed for managing conditions like heart failure and hypertension, also pose significant risks to hearing health. Medications such as furosemide and bumetanide can result in ototoxic effects, particularly when administered at high doses or to patients with renal impairment.
The mechanism by which loop diuretics contribute to hearing issues involves alterations in fluid balance within the inner ear. Changes in electrolyte levels and fluid concentrations can disrupt the delicate environment necessary for optimal auditory function. Consequently, healthcare providers must carefully evaluate the risks against the benefits when prescribing these medications and ensure that patients receive appropriate monitoring throughout their treatment.

What Is the Impact of Medications on Hair Cells?
Medications can inflict considerable damage on the hair cells located within the inner ear, which are essential for converting sound vibrations into electrical signals. This damage may result in sensorineural hearing loss, characterised by a decreased ability to perceive sound and understand speech. The biological processes involved in this damage include:
– Disruption of mitochondrial function within hair cells
– Induction of apoptosis or cell death in these vital cells
– Impairment of signal transduction processes that affect auditory perception
Understanding these mechanisms is crucial for developing strategies aimed at protecting hair cells from the detrimental effects of ototoxic medications. Ongoing research into protective agents and interventions continues to progress, focusing on preserving hearing health.

The Role of Reactive Oxygen Species in Ototoxicity
Reactive oxygen species (ROS) produced by certain medications can significantly contribute to ototoxicity. These unstable molecules may lead to oxidative stress, damaging cellular components within the inner ear, including hair cells and auditory neurons. Medications such as aminoglycosides and cisplatin are particularly known for their ability to generate ROS, perpetuating a cycle of cellular damage.
Research indicates that antioxidants could potentially alleviate these effects by neutralising ROS and shielding auditory structures from harm. Investigating the use of antioxidant therapies alongside ototoxic medications represents a promising area for future research, with the potential to enhance hearing health outcomes for affected patients.

Examining the Role of Antioxidants in Hearing Preservation
Antioxidants have attracted attention for their potential to counteract the ototoxic effects of certain medications. By neutralising reactive oxygen species generated during medication metabolism, antioxidants may offer protective benefits for auditory structures. Commonly investigated antioxidants, such as vitamins C and E, have demonstrated promise in preclinical studies for their capacity to protect against ototoxicity.
However, while antioxidants could provide potential advantages, their effectiveness is not universally established. Healthcare providers should carefully evaluate individual patient needs and existing research when considering antioxidant supplementation, ensuring that strategies for hearing preservation are tailored to each unique situation.

How Is Hearing Loss Diagnosed by Healthcare Providers?
Diagnosing hearing loss necessitates a comprehensive approach that utilises various tests. Audiometry is a commonly employed method to evaluate a patient’s hearing capacity across a range of frequencies. Otoacoustic emissions (OAEs) testing may also be conducted, measuring sound waves generated by the inner ear in response to auditory stimuli.
Healthcare providers will additionally perform a thorough review of the patient’s medical history, taking into account factors such as medication use and previous hearing assessments. This multifaceted diagnostic process ensures accurate identification of any impairments in hearing and informs subsequent management strategies.

How Do Hearing Aids and Cochlear Implants Assist Patients?
Hearing aids and cochlear implants are vital tools for managing hearing loss resulting from medications. Hearing aids amplify sound, substantially improving communication for individuals with mild to moderate hearing loss. In contrast, cochlear implants directly stimulate the auditory nerve and are typically suited for those with severe to profound hearing loss.
These devices can significantly enhance the quality of life for patients, enabling them to engage more fully in social and professional contexts. Ensuring access to audiological services and educational resources regarding these interventions is crucial for maximising their benefits and efficacy.
